Techniques for Maximum Flavor and Moisture
Simple cake mix recipes truly shine when you apply a few chef-inspired tweaks that amplify moisture and depth. Substituting a portion of the water with brewed coffee, fruit puree, or buttermilk intensifies flavor while keeping the cake tender. Mixing the batter just until combined prevents overdevelopment of gluten, ensuring a soft, delicate texture slice after slice.
Replace oil with melted butter for a richer mouthfeel and better flavor layering.
Fold in citrus zest or extracts during the final stir to preserve aroma and freshness.
Add a pinch of sea salt on top before baking to enhance sweetness and balance.
One-Bowl Chocolate Upgrade
For a decadent chocolate variation, combine the mix with cocoa powder, a splash of espresso, and a handful of chocolate chips in a single bowl. Stir gently until the chips are just distributed, then pour into a lined pan and bake at 350°F (175°C) until the center springs back lightly. The result is a fudgy, aromatic cake that feels indulgent without the complexity of from-scratch recipes.

Storage, Serving, and Lasting Impressions
Proper storage preserves the texture and flavor of simple cake mix recipes, allowing you to prepare ahead without sacrificing quality. Cool the cake completely, then wrap it tightly in parchment and store it at room temperature for up to two days or freeze for longer enjoyment. When serving, a light dusting of powdered sugar or a few fresh berries adds a polished touch that feels special without extra effort.
